EO56 UUL is a 2006 BMW X5 in Black with a 2,993cc diesel engine. This vehicle has been through 27 MOT tests with a personal pass rate of 66.7%.
Across all 2006 BMW X5 models, the average MOT pass rate is 72.7% with a typical mileage of 98,483 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a BMW X5 f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 31,544 recorded failures. If you're considering buying EO56 UUL, it's worth having these areas checked by a mechanic before committing.
The BMW X5 typically stays on UK roads for around 25 years. At 20 years old, this BMW X5 is approaching the upper end of the typical lifespan for this model.
